If you are a lover of denim, then there’s a chance that you have heard of Georges Marciano.  He is a designer that has been creating quality, timeless, and impeccably tailored denim garments since 1978, but has now launched a new line of apparel for both men and women that takes classic styles and gives them a modern twist.

One of Georges Marciano’s new men’s designs that are available on www.georgesmarciano.com is the GM- Sutter Western Shirt.  For years, it seems that the prominent colors of denim were all about the darker shades like indigo and ink, but the lighter shades have now re-immerged on the fashion scene.  This western style shirt has a mix of lighter and darker bleached denim tones, as well as the pointed detailed stitching along the shoulders that mirrors the flap button pockets.  Created in 100% lightweight cotton, it will not be stiff and will move with you.

Another take on the same style of men’s shirts is the GM- Shutter Western Shirt.  This one has similar stitching details as the lighter denim one, but they are more muted with the richness of the indigo and medium, splashed-on looking denim wash.  I also like the details of the rounded hemline and the ability to roll up the sleeves in both fabrics.  Either can be purchased for $175, which may sound a little pricey, but not when they are from an iconic denim designer like Georges Marciano, who creates items that reflect the past with a cutting-edge appeal.

If you are not a denim person, but love traditional designs like the Polo shirt, then the GM- Polo may be for you.  This shirt is constructed of 100% quality cotton, has a nicely tailored it with the point collar, button-down neckline, and perfect sleeve/body length.  This would be fantastic with a pair of jeans or khakis and can be purchased for $85, in a myriad of colors to fit your style.
